About Greater Zion Stadium
Greater Zion Stadium is a name shared by two distinct venues in Utah: one on the campus of Utah Tech University in St. George, and another associated with Southern Utah University in Cedar City. This page covers the Utah Tech St. George site, a multi-use stadium with a rich history and a clear, fan-friendly setup. Whether you’re attending a football game, a concert, or a campus event, we’ve got you covered with seating details, parking tips, transit options, and nearby hotel and dining partners to help you plan a straightforward, stress-free visit.
Located at 501 S 700 E, St. George, UT 84770, Greater Zion Stadium at Utah Tech seats 10,500 for athletic events, featuring an East Grandstand with aluminum benches and a West Grandstand with seated-back chairs. Seating, Parking & Venue Information
- Two distinct venues share the name Greater Zion Stadium: Utah Tech University, St. George (address: 501 S 700 E, St. George, UT 84770) and Southern Utah University, Cedar City (address: 351 W University Blvd, Cedar City, UT 84720).
- Utah Tech’s Greater Zion Stadium capacity is listed as 10,500 for athletic events, with east and west grandstands (East Grandstand: aluminum benches; West Grandstand: seated-back chairs). Seating chart reference available on Utah Tech materials. (Sources: Utah Tech events page; Stadium Journey) ([utahtech.edu](https://utahtech.edu/events/greater-zion-stadium/?utm_source=openai))
- History/renaming: the St. George stadium was built as Hansen Stadium, later Legend Solar Stadium, Trailblazer Stadium, and was renamed Greater Zion Stadium in 2020 under a naming-rights deal. (Sources: Wikipedia, Utah Tech pages) ([en.wikipedia.org](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Greater_Zion_Stadium?utm_source=openai))
- Notable events at the St. George site include the Paradise Bowl (2002–2003) and the Dixie Rotary Bowl (through 2008); Real Salt Lake played a pre-season match there in 2007. (Sources: Utah Tech/StadiumJourney; Wikipedia) ([utahtechtrailblazers.com](https://utahtechtrailblazers.com/sports/2017/8/3/TrailblazerStadium.aspx?utm_source=openai))
